Online news outlets Inquirer.net and
Rappler may soon be facing libel charges for publishing reports claiming that
Presidential Spokesperson Atty. Salvador Panelo “recommended” or “endorsed” the
granting of executive clemency for convicted rapist-murderer, former Calauan
Mayor Antonio Sanchez.
Panelo said he
will be filing appropriate libe complaints against the two news outfits for their
“malicious reports which are meant to discredit him.
Atty. Salvador Panelo (photo credit to owner) |
Inquirer.net used the word
“recommended” while Rappler used the word “endorsed” when Panelo insisted he
only referred the letter to the appropriate agency or department.
“I’m filing a libel case against
Inquirer.net and Rappler for publishing these malicious articles immediately,”
Panelo said in a media interview on Tuesday but did not give an exact date when
to file the charges.
Because of the words used in the
report, Panelo said, “people are saying now that I really did something about
the so-called release.”
The
Presidential spokesperson reiterated that he merely wrote a letter to the Board
of Pardons and Parole (BPP) to act on the request of Sanchez’s daughter, Marie
Antonelvie, to grant her father pardon but “never recommended anything.”
“The application was referred to the
Bureau of Pardons and Parole [sic] for their evaluation. We have nothing to do
with it. But then they’re writing an article saying I recommended, I did not,”
Panelo said.
He said he asked both Inquirer.net and
Rappler to correct their reports but they have not tried to do so.
“I demanded rectification from NetInquirer
(Inquirer.net) but I have not received any report from them. I sent a text
earlier just before the press briefing. I also texted Pia (Ranada of Rappler)
and I told her no intervention, I explained to her but she has not responded.
She just said ‘got it.,’” Panelo said.
